Will we see WooCommerce block checkout support ever? WooCommerce PayPal Payments plugin only supports instant payment buttons on block checkout

Today WooCommerce support confirmed that the WooCommerce PayPal Payments plugin only supports instant payment buttons (Google Pay, Apple Pay, PayPal instant pay) at the top of the block checkout, not classic. These instant payment methods are the norm these days. Having the user face a big checkout form while other sites have instant payment buttons on their checkout is a huge pain point and adds serious friction to the conversion process. I know the Stripe plugin can handle this but this client uses PayPal Payments and wants to use it for all their payments including Google Pay and Apple Pay. Works great on single product and cart pages but not on the checkout.

You can already use the block checkout with Bricks. I’ve used it on a few sites. It’s a PITA to style but it works fine. You just can’t edit it with Bricks since it’s block based. You can’t really edit much of it at all even in Gutenberg
